It does this through two large tail muscles — the caudofemoral muscles — that pull the legs backwards during each step. In the bipedal two-legged T. When the rhythm of a swinging tail achieves resonance — "the biggest movement response with the least amount of effort" — that rhythm is known as the tail's "natural frequency," van Bijlert said. The natural frequency in a T. Related: In images: A new look at T.
Standing in as the researchers' model T. The study authors scanned and modeled Trix's tail bones, referencing marks on the well-preserved vertebrae that showed where ligaments attached. From this digital bone and ligament reconstruction, they created a biomechanical model of the tail.
